ubuntu常用命令汇集
一、文件组织结构
/
为根目录,为系统最基本的目录
/home
下有用户名的文件夹,该文件夹就是~
为主目录,为日常使用的目录
命令在终端中输入,需要注意当前所在的文件夹
二、常用命令
创建文件夹
(sudo) mkdir xx # 创建文件夹
(sudo) rm -r XX # 删除文件夹
sudo rm -rf # -rf,表示不询问,把子目录也都删除,慎用,非常危险
cd xxx # 进入文件夹
cd .. # 用相对路径回到上一级目录
cd / # 进入根目录
sudo chmod -R 777 xxx # 给文件夹及所有子文件夹授权
sudo chmod 777 * # *一般是指全部,这里就是指当前文件夹下的所有文件(不包含下一级目录)
pwd # 显示当前的路径
sudo cp xxx(文件名,加后缀) /data/~~~(要复制的路径) # 复制某个文件到另一个文件下
watch -n 2 nvidia-smi # 每隔2秒更新一下nvidia面板,n 后的数字可以更改
(sudo) apt -y install htop.x86_64 # 安装htop,htop可以查看电脑CPU和内存使用状况,等于windows的任务管理器
tar xvf archive_name.tar # 解压tar文件
tar tvf archive_name.tar # 查看tar文件
unzip test.zip # 解压 *.zip文件
unzip -l jasper.zip # 查看 *.zip文件的内容
显示当前文件夹下有哪些文件和文件夹
ls
ls -a # 查看隐藏文件
ls -l # 查看详细信息,包括权限
vim的使用
vim是一个非常经典的文件编辑工具
vim hello.py
即可进入编辑
进入模式之后可以点击键盘的i
或者a
插入,即可输入,方向键可以控制,详细的命令很多,可以自行查询
编辑完成之后,需要点击esc
退出编辑模式
随后点击shift + :
,就是输入:,然后输入w表示保存,随后输入q表示退出
即输入:wq
完成保存退出,后面有时候需要加上!
表示强制
三、权限
root是最高权限,在此状态下不要轻易动一些东西,危险
sudo -i
进入root模式
或者
sudo su
exit # 退出root模式
发现文件上有锁或者x说明当前是不能使用的,需要授权
权限包括三个部分,用户user、组group、其他人other
权限内容也包括方面,读r、写w、执行x,对应的编码是4、2、1